Yes, this is what you think it is. This is the final episode of We Come From Queens. It has been an amazing four and a half years of growing as women, making new friends, being exposed to various opportunities and being embraced in this way.We thank everyone that came out to our 100th episode celebration. It was a bittersweet send off though we did not make the announcement then as to not bring the vibe down.We are grateful for this journey and look forward to whatever life has in store for us.We will keep the store open until Jan 31, 2019 so get your orders in by then. All of the podcast social media will remain up though it probably will be less activity happening there.The episodes will still be available at least until 2020. We will be transferring them over to this website and so you probably will not be able to access all on soundcloud.You can follow our personal social media accountsCadacia Twitter: @Cadacia_ | Instagram: @statusfroMonique Twitter / Instagram: @AmazelifeOnce again we thank you from the bottom to the top of our hearts for your continued support!Best,We Come From Queens Podcast

Today is the day! I finally do a crossover episode with one of my favorite podcast We Come From Queens. A little back story when I first started my show they were one of the first podcast I reached out to do a collaboration. 2 years later, signed adoption papers, and some black girl magic we made it happen. Today's episode is all about what the hell happens after you graduate college. It can be such an exciting and scary time in your life. We discuss everything from paying back your student loans to the journey of finding your first job. Episode 11: Rico along with the ladies from #WeComeFromQueens podcast discuss the natural hair process and why they hate when people touch their hair. Is your hair still a distraction in the workplace? Is biracial women now the face of the natural movement? Later, the ladies react to Shea Moisture commercial, Kendrick's Lamar's 'Humble' video, Trans Women and Rachel Dolezal being 'Trans Black.' On this week's episode of Play Cousins, we had a packed house of special guests who shared tons of amazing stories, dropped all kinds of gems, and shared a lot of laughs. Alley Olivier, created the inspiring brand, Brooklyn Buttah, discussed getting her journalism start, to running her own team. Thomas Knox may seem like a familiar face, but his Date While You Wait campaign has taken off to being more than just a fun subway distraction. The ladies of We Come From Queens also joined us, who talked to us about their podcast journey and what it's been like to use their voices for something positive.
